Hastings chases a serial killer who preys on the glitterati
Tony Frazer takes a wide berth when he sees the homeless man. A millionaire playboy, he does not consort with street people, and is in the process of skirting the derelict, eyes averted, when the stranger calls his name. The king of the society pages turns just in time to be struck by three silenced bullets, slumping to his knees and dying there in the gutter.
Although witnesses insist the killer was a homeless man, homicide lieutenant Frank Hastings sees signs of a professional at work—the kind who kills quietly, then disappears into the night. In fact, as Hastings learns, the killer thinks himself a crusader—a kind of Robin Hood with a pistol—and he has many more assassinations planned. San Francisco society had better take cover, for this killer has a thirst for blue blood.

The latest Lt. Hastings mystery ( Hire a Hangman ) is a casually accurate procedural rich in plot, characters--including suspects--and San Francisco color. From Valentine's Day through the next six weeks, a series of powerful and wealthy men are shot to death on the street, the weapon the .22 favored by professional hitmen. The cops finally connect the victims as rather nasty members of the ultra-exclusive Rabelais Club (a combination of the real-life Bohemian and Pacific Union clubs). Old scandals (a hooker's death covered up, a notorious high-stakes poker circle), heavy political and media pressure and glimpses (for us) of the killer's mind-set lead up to Hastings's harrowing, climactic confrontation with the murderer. The range of characters is great, including an old sportsman/socialite, an obsequious professional waiter, a garish fat lady running a halfway house. And while semi-stolid Hastings is in charge, his co-head of Homicide, the appealing Lt. Friedman (``I spent a lot of time in school standing in the corner. . . . I figured it was time well spent'') provides crucial balance. First-rate.
